Big man Dwight Howard came off the bench to score 16 points, 10 rebounds and four blocks in the Los Angeles Lakers‘ 120-101 win against the Charlotte Hornets on Sunday at Staples Center.

“I’m grateful. I think myself and the fans have been through a lot together. But just to be back here, man, it means a lot. I just take it all in, every second, every moment on the court. It’s valuable. Hopefully the fans enjoy when we go out there and put everything on the line. I just try to bring that energy and that effort and that intensity every night – and have fun doing it,” Howard said, per ESPN.
